Long-term care hospital overview

Vibra Hospital Of Southeastern Massachusetts is an long-term care hospital in New Bedford, MA. Long-term care hospitals specialize in treating patients who require extended hospital-level care, typically with average stays of 25 days or more, for complex medical conditions that cannot be managed in a standard acute care setting.

Vibra Hospital Of Southeastern Massachusetts performs better than the national rate for discharging patients back to the community. Medicare spending per beneficiary is below the national average. 10 physicians are affiliated with this facility.

When choosing a long-term care hospital in New Bedford, MA, consider infection rates, functional improvement scores, readmission rates, and the facility's experience with extended acute care. LTCHs serve patients with complex conditions requiring prolonged hospital-level care that standard hospitals and skilled nursing facilities cannot provide.

What is a long-term care hospital?

A long-term care hospital (LTCH) like Vibra Hospital Of Southeastern Massachusetts provides extended hospital-level care for patients with complex medical conditions. Unlike standard hospitals, LTCHs have average stays of 25+ days and specialize in weaning patients from ventilators, managing complex wounds, and treating multi-system organ failure.
